About Orchestrades
The Orchestrades Universelles are no longer organized. This large gathering of youth orchestras enlivened Brive-la-Gaillarde every August from 1984 to 2011. The 2012 edition was cancelled for financial reasons and the festival never resumed.
For 28 years, the Orchestrades brought together hundreds of young musicians (aged 10 to 25) from around the world for a week of free concerts throughout the city, culminating in a monumental final concert gathering over 1,100 musicians and choristers — an attendance that earned them an entry in the record book in the classical music events category.

A festival discontinued since 2011
The Orchestrades Universelles no longer take place. Created in 1984 on the initiative of Simone du Breuil, president of SOJE (Symphonie des Orchestres de Jeunes d'Europe), they were held every summer in Brive-la-Gaillarde until 2011. The 2012 edition was cancelled for financial reasons and the event has never been reconstituted since.
History
For nearly three decades, the Orchestrades hosted French and foreign youth orchestras for about ten days of concerts throughout the city. As early as 1993, the number of participants exceeded 1,100 musicians and choristers gathered for the final concert, which earned the event an entry in the record book in the "classical music events" category. The musical direction was notably provided by Vincent Thomas from 2009.
Tribute to the Founder
Simone du Breuil, founder and soul of the festival, passed away in July 2024. A final tribute concert, free of charge, was organized by SOJE on Sunday, July 6, 2025, at the collegiate church of Saint-Martin de Brive, bringing together former musicians and conductors. This was a one-off farewell and not a resumption of the festival.
